The Microchip ATXMEGA64A3U-AU: A High-Performance 8/16-bit AVR XMEGA A3U Microcontroller
In the realm of embedded systems design, selecting the right microcontroller is paramount to balancing performance, power efficiency, and peripheral integration. The Microchip ATXMEGA64A3U-AU stands out as a formidable member of the AVR XMEGA A3U family, engineered to deliver robust computational power and exceptional connectivity for demanding applications.
At its core, this microcontroller leverages an 8/16-bit AVR CPU architecture capable of operating at speeds up to 32 MHz, enabling it to execute complex instructions with high efficiency. Its performance is further amplified by a single-cycle I/O access and hardware multiplier, making it well-suited for real-time control tasks and data processing. The device is built on a high-performance, low-power picoPower technology, ensuring extended battery life in portable applications.
A defining feature of the ATXMEGA64A3U-AU is its integrated USB 2.0 full-speed controller with embedded transceiver. This built-in USB capability simplifies the design of communication interfaces, allowing the microcontroller to act as a USB device without external components, which is ideal for PC peripherals, consumer gadgets, and development tools.

The microcontroller is equipped with a rich set of peripherals, including a 12-bit, 2 Msps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C) for high-speed, precise data acquisition, and multiple DACs for analog output control. It also features four USARTs, two Two-Wire Interfaces (I2C), and three SPI ports, providing extensive connectivity options for sensors, displays, and other external components.
With 64KB of in-system self-programmable Flash memory and 4KB of EEPROM, it offers ample space for application code and data storage, while its 4KB SRAM ensures smooth operation during data-intensive processes. The inclusion of a DMA controller enhances system performance by enabling peripheral-to-memory data transfers without CPU intervention, reducing power consumption and freeing up processing resources.
Security and reliability are addressed through hardware-based AES and DES crypto engines, protecting data integrity and confidentiality in sensitive applications. Additionally, the device supports advanced features like an Event System for inter-peripheral communication, a programmable multilevel interrupt controller, and sleep modes with fast wake-up for power-aware designs.
Target applications span industrial automation, IoT edge nodes, medical devices, and advanced human-machine interfaces (HMI), where its blend of processing muscle, connectivity, and analog capabilities excels.
